  7. I recently had young from my trio of browns (1m, 2f). To make it difficult for my boy the girls spawned at seperate times instead of together thats how I know I got albinos and browns from one and browns and light yellow/white with blue eyes from the other one. Poor boy was in the cave for weeks and so hungry at the end of the second spawn. I knocked the cave over for a week or two to let him recoup because the girls were ready again. Just stood the cave back up on thursday and have him guarding eggs from both girls this morning. My browns started out very pale with almost see through tail ends and over the week or two have darkened up. But the albinos and whitish ones have never changed at all. I find it funny how with albino young you get some that are yellow and some that are almost white. Have seen it in the adults with the females nearly always being the white ones. The white albino also seems to be growing alot slower but had the same conditions as the yellow ones.
